A trail connecting Virginia’s Northern Neck to history, nature, and recreation. The 16-mile Dahlgren Railroad Heritage Trail follows the route of the 1940s Dahlgren Branch Rail Line, and stretches across King George County just south of the Potomac River in Virginia’s Northern Neck. The trail is open for walking, running, cycling, and other non-motorized recreational uses. The trail is comprised of 240 acres of preserved sanctuary for native wildlife and natural beauty.
